The Centenario is the latest supercar from the company that has been producing exotic, drool-inducing poster cars for many years. It was unveiled at the 2016 Geneva Motor Show and will be limited to just 20 coupes and 20 roadster models.

It is powered by a V12 engine that produces 759 horsepower and sports a carbon fiber bodywork that is wrapped around an upgraded Aventador Superveloce frame. This combination lets it reach 60 mph in fewer than 2.8 seconds and has a top speed of 217 mph.

The car also features an adjustable rear wing, as well as dynamic steering, which increases the agility of the car at low speeds by turning the wheels in the opposite direction of the steering angle, or increasing stability at high speeds by following the wheel's direction. It's an impressive and distinctive machine.

Despite its impressive performance, the Centenario is comfortable to drive on any road. The bucket-shaped seats hug and support the driver when taking fast turns. The interior is decorated with the same high-end materials as the Lamborghini Aventador, including leather and Alcantara.
